United Maritime Corp Form 6-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
United Maritime Corporation, a foreign private issuer headquartered in Athens, Greece, filed this Form 6-K on November 21, 2025. The filing reports on the third quarter and nine-month period ended September 30, 2025. The report incorporates a press release dated November 11, 2025, and includes Management's Discussion and Analysis (MD&A) along with unaudited interim condensed consolidated financial statements.

One specific financial action is disclosed:
- Dividend Declaration: The Company declared a quarterly cash dividend of $0.09 per share.
Material Changes and Strategic Developments
While specific comparative financial changes are not detailed in the text, the filing highlights a strategic operational change:
- Strategic Investment: The Company announced a strategic investment in Artificial Intelligence (AI) focused on ship management technology.
